Former OpenAI CTO's New Venture Hits $12B Milestone

Key Insights

Mira Murati, former CTO of OpenAI, has led her new AI startup, Thinking Machines Lab, to a remarkable $12 billion valuation within just five months. This rapid growth underscores the significant investor confidence in Murati's leadership and the company's potential.

Salesforce Unveils AI-Powered Slack Makeover with 30 New Features

Salesforce has announced a major update to Slack, introducing over 30 new AI-driven features aimed at enhancing workplace productivity and collaboration. Key enhancements include: - Advanced Slackbot capabilities for drafting content, summarizing conversations, and answering queries. - Integration with Salesforce CRM and third-party apps to provide context-aware assistance. - Proactive recommendations during video calls, such as surfacing relevant Salesforce records when key names are mentioned.

Salesforce Ramps Up Agentic AI Research with New Foundry Project

Salesforce has launched the AI Foundry, a new initiative aimed at accelerating agentic AI research and development. The project focuses on: - Bridging foundational research and product innovation through collaboration with strategic customers and academic partners. - Developing AI tools for high-impact enterprise areas, including simulated environments for testing AI agents and enhancing solutions like Agentforce Voice. - Exploring ambient intelligence to provide proactive, context-aware assistance without constant user input.

VHA Deploys Salesforce-Powered Agentic Operating System, Saving Thousands of Staff Hours for Front-Line Veteran Care

The Veterans Health Administration (VHA) has implemented a Salesforce-powered agentic operating system, resulting in significant operational efficiencies. Key outcomes include: - Transitioning from static reporting to automated problem-solving, eliminating administrative silos. - Freeing thousands of staff hours, allowing more focus on direct Veteran support. - Creating a connected performance management layer, enhancing care delivery across facilities.
